What drugs should not be taken with gabapentin?

Gabapentin can interact with losartan, ethacrynic acid, caffeine, phenytoin, mefloquine, magnesium oxide, cimetidine, naproxen , sevelamer and morphine . Gabapentin use is contraindicated in patients with myasthenia gravis or myoclonus.

How long can you take gabapentin for nerve pain?

In all, 37 studies provided information on 5914 participants. Most studies used oral gabapentin or gabapentin encarbil at doses of 1200 mg or more daily in different neuropathic pain conditions, predominantly postherpetic neuralgia and painful diabetic neuropathy . Study duration was typically four to 12 weeks .

Is gabapentin like Xanax?

What’s the difference between gabapentin and Xanax ? Gabapentin and Xanax ( alprazolam ) are used to treat anxiety. A difference is that gabapentin is primarily an anti-seizure (anticonvulsant) drug used for preventing seizures and for treating post-herpetic neuralgia, the pain that follows an episode of shingles.

Is there a recall on gabapentin?

On December 19, 2019 FDA is warning that serious breathing difficulties may occur in patients using gabapentin (brand names Neurontin, Gralise, Horizant) or pregabalin (brand names Lyrica, Lyrica CR) who have respiratory risk factors.

Is gabapentin an anti inflammatory?

Gabapentin is used as an anticonvulsant, sedative, anxiolytic, and to treat chronic pain syndromes, including neuropathic pain. It is used to treat neuropathic pain that does not respond to nonsteroidal anti – in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) or opiates.
